Transaction a29c01fb0ebdd75baff5dcd58866b5bae8687fc4b67d5b571e84d46c6707769d

124 Input
1 Outputs
  • a29c01fb0ebdd75baff5dcd58866b5bae8687fc4b67d5b571e84d46c6707769d:0
  • value  2494090434
    address  3FFK5DhW2aUcvZens1xE8gyYHoxnVanHe1